Early Release: Methods Devour Themselves: A Collaboration between Rev Left, PoliTreks, and the authors of Methods Devour Themselves

Do you like political philosophy? Do you like science fiction and fantasy? Do you like breaking down the artificial cultural and intellectual barriers between the two? Then we have a treat for you!  This episode is a totally novel collaboration between our show, PoliTreks (a podcast which combines Trekky Fandom with cultural and political analysis), Benjanun Sriduangkaew and J-Moufawad Paul (co-authors of Methods Devour Themselves).  DESCRIPTION OF THE BOOK: "Methods Devour Themselves is a dialogue between fiction and non-fiction. Inspired by Quentin Meillassoux's Science Fiction and Extro-Science Fiction that was paired with an Isaac Asimov short story, this book examines the ways in which stories can provoke philosophical interventions and philosophical essays can provoke stories. Alternating between Benjanun Sriduangkaew's fiction and J. Moufawad-Paul's non-fiction, Methods Devour Themselves is an interstitial project that brings fiction and essay into a unique, avant-garde whole."  Check out the book here: http://www.zero-books.net/books/methods-devour-themselves
